Dual 2GHz G5 10.3.8
My G5 seems to behave very odd at startup - it boots, loads and the
desktop pictures appear.
I then get the "pizza wheel of death" for a considerable period of
time (2-3 minutes +) before all the icons appear and I can get down
to business.
Try deleting fontTablesAnnex. I read somewhere that update 10.3.6
introduced a new version of ATS framework (v1.8.5) that fixed some
font bugs and introduced a new one. If you have a heap of PostScript
fonts in your System, they are each scanned at login and it may be
that each scan adds to and bloats the fontTablesAnnex cache. It is
hoped Update 10.3.9, due 'real soon now', will include ATS.framework
1.8.6 which might fix this.
~/System/Library/Caches/fontTablesAnnex
